Overview of TC Treatment for Breast Cancer

TC treatment for breast cancer refers to a chemotherapy combination of docetaxel (T) and cyclophosphamide (C). It is commonly prescribed as adjuvant chemotherapy, meaning it is given after surgery to eliminate any remaining cancer cells and reduce the risk of recurrence.

This regimen is often selected because it provides strong cancer-fighting effectiveness while avoiding certain long-term heart-related side effects associated with other chemotherapy combinations. TC therapy is typically administered in cycles over several months under close medical supervision.

FAQ

1. What is TC treatment for breast cancer?
It is a chemotherapy regimen combining docetaxel and cyclophosphamide, commonly used after surgery to reduce recurrence risk.

2. How long does TC chemotherapy last?
Treatment usually involves 4 cycles given every 3 weeks, though schedules may vary.

3. Is TC treatment effective for early-stage breast cancer?
Yes, it is widely used and effective for many early-stage and high-risk cases.

4. What are common side effects of TC therapy?
Possible side effects include fatigue, hair loss, nausea, and temporary low blood counts, which are closely monitored.
